Output 249928dfaaf5dfb176363ce1c8b6617d5bd6812eb13c2de0393700bb36c51664:27

value
806644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25cf398841a543e08cdbff3ac24eb1b759c61358 OP_EQUAL
address
358wAsKvMp4EpHQsNTHv4At8ALFpk1qWk9
transaction
249928dfaaf5dfb176363ce1c8b6617d5bd6812eb13c2de0393700bb36c51664
spent
true